Company Background

Alta Forest Products in partnership with Itochu Building Products is the world's largest producer of wood fence boards, specializing in Western Red Cedar and other premium species found in the Pacific and Inland Northwest forests. In addition to producing fence boards and pallet stock lumber, Alta's zero-wood-waste sawmills produce by‑products such as wood chips, sawdust, mulch, and biofuel. Headquartered in centrally located Chehalis, Washington, Alta operates in multiple Northwest rural communities including Morton, WA;
Winlock, WA;
Shelton, WA;
Amanda Park, WA;
Lewiston, ;
Bonners Ferry, ; and Naples, .

The Role

This is an entry‑level labor position, responsible for quickly and efficiently separating and stacking finished lumber in carts to help complete and fulfill orders. Excellent opportunities for advancement.

Starting pay $21.75 per hour plus a shift differential of $1.50/hr
, if applicable.

Work schedule:

Monday – Thursday, 10‑hour shifts.

This position is classified as “safety‑sensitive,” meaning that an accident in this role could result in loss of life, serious bodily injury, or significant damage to property or the environment, and candidates will be subject to comprehensive pre‑employment drug screening, inclusive of marijuana (THC).

Position Type

This is a full‑time position and overtime work may be required as projects or job duties demand.

Responsibilities
  • Pulling lumber that comes off a conveyor belt
  • Sorting lumber by size, grade, and species
  • Stack lumber into carts
  • General labor and cleanup
  • Meet productivity goals while maintaining safety in every aspect of the job
  • Other duties as assigned
